Foundation Overview
Based in Harrison, NY, C Larry And Ingrid Davis has awarded 143 grants totaling $777,350 to organizations in New York, Georgia and 7 other states, plus international recipients. Individual grants range from $100 to $47,500, with a median award of $2,000.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
-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
-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
-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
-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
